How many miles can you get on one tank of gas if your tank holds 18 gallons and you get 22 miles per
gallon?

Multiply the two. The units will cancel out. 22 miles per gallon can be expressed as 22 miles / 1 gallon, so you can write the following:
18 gallons * 22 miles / 1 gallon
Which simplifies to 18 * 22 miles = 396 miles.
